I have the relative misfortune (some would say different!) of having rather hard to control, curly hair when it starts to go longer than about an inch on top. As a result, to avoid more regular cuts, I try to use gel or wax to control my hair and give it hold for my working day. Some products work, some don't, and sadly this V05 doesn't really completely do the job for me.

For a few hours, it's a great product, giving my hair a sort of wet look and holding firm, but any form of touching it seems to make the firm hold disappear, and it just ends up feeling and looking greasy as opposed to controlled. Even without touching, it has a lack of hold once the afternoon comes around, bearing in mind I usually apply it at about 8.30 in the morning.

Applying it is very easy, with the flip top nozzle meaning you can just squeeze and the gel comes out, and not too quickly either. Thumbs up for the containe, then! The gel feel slimy on your hands, and once you've run it through your hair or applied as much of it as you want, the problem is that your hands are greasy with the gel, and then subsequently sticky if it tries on your hands, giving you a tacky feel to your hands. You'll need warm water to wash it off, but this isn't too much of a bind.

The gel smells quite nice, though, not too chemically, but with enough of a pleasant smell to not worry about whether someone is going to turn their nose up at you when you walk near them. It is easy to wash out, and I don't wash my hair every day, so this is ideal. However, the main problem is still that it doesn't hold for long enough once touched, and winds up looking and feeling just too greasy. For this, I don't really use it much. The smell is nice, so if my hair is short and I'm going out at night, I might use it for brief effect and then subsequent smell, but for longer hold I'd probably try something else.

Price wise, you can probably get this for quite a decent price from Boots or Superdrug, and you can often get them on offer, but generally it'll cost you just under the £3 mark, depending on where you shop. However, I wouldn't necessarily recommend this product if it's long lasting hold without a greasy look that you're after.

Gel is a water-based product which isn't going to be terribly effective at controlling curly hair. You should invest in something that's more expensive, more like a wax or a putty that doesn't dry out but has a much lower moisture content.
